Chip Ganassi Racing Teams and Kennametal Renew Partnership with New Multi-Year Contract


(LATROBE, PA) - Kennametal Inc. is proud to announce a multi-year renewal of its machining technology partnership with Chip Ganassi Teams (CGRT). Kennametal began its relationship with CGRT in 1993. This renewed relationship occurs in the wake of Dario Franchitti and Scott Dixon's dramatic first and second-place finish at the 2012 Indianapolis 500.

With cars competing in multiple series -the IZOD Indy Car Series, the NASCAR Sprint Cup Series, and the Rolex GRAND-AM Series - Chip Ganassi Racing holds a record of 15 championships and more than 140 victories, including four Indianapolis 500 wins. This year marks Franchitti's third win, (one of only 10 drivers in the history of the race to do so), a Daytona 500, a Brickyard 400, and four Rolex 24 at Daytona victories. RACER Magazine named them its 2010 "Team of the Year."

Kennametal has expanded the 19-year metalcutting partnership by providing Ganassi's Indy machine shop with proprietary Precision Surface Management Technology by Kennametal Extrude Hone. Kennametal's advanced surface finishing solutions deliver uniform, repeatable, predictable results by removing the rough cast surfaces that restrict the efficiency of critical engine components and performance competence.

Kennametal tooling and services deliver high performance throughout the automotive industry, machining such critical components as engine blocks, cylinder heads, pistons, crankshafts, gear boxes, suspension parts, exhaust systems, brake parts, and wheels. The company's advanced tooling systems are used in turning, milling and holemaking operations to machine cast irons, steels, stainless steels and aluminum, as well as more exotic metals and alloys, including titanium, magnesium and Inconel.
